Ahmedabad, Bangalore, Calicut, Chennai, Cochin, Hyderabad, Jammu, Mumbai, Pune, New Delhi and Sharjah. Mettupalayam is the starting point for two of the Ghat Roads into the Nilgiri Hills. Subsequently it has established itself for the trade of fresh fruits & vegetables coming down from the hills and also for produce that grows in the plains and is destined for the hills. Fresh produce from here is supplied to most parts of Coimbatore district.
For a magnificent view of the hillside covered with forests, a train journey from Mettupalyam to Ooty is recommended. This narrow gauge mountain train winds through 46 km of forests, tea plantations, 16 tunnels, and more than 250 bridges, starting from Mettupalayam on the plains. Moving at a pace little faster than walking, the journey takes four and half to five hours, but is more compensated by stunning views. Black Thunder a water theme park located 3 km from the town that attracts many tourists.
